I was considering the Summit out of Tampa as well, and shared some of your concerns, so I browsed through a lot of posts, reviews and Youtube videos. If it makes you feel any better, the only complaints that were truly consistent were the lack of closed storage in the bathroom and the chair not fitting under the desk. For most of the other complaints, there were about as many people that were satisfied, happy or OK with the balcony furniture and room storage, as were complaining - YMMV. I think some people noted that the room storage was different, although still adequate, and the balcony issues may depend on how much you use the balcony.
